Aaron Rai wins PGA Championship, makes history for England
Aaron Rai made history by winning the 108th PGA Championship, becoming the first Englishman to do so since 1919. He finished the tournament with a score of 5-under 65, outperforming competitors including Jon Rahm and Alex Smalley. Rai's victory marks a significant achievement in English golf history.
